Nobuyuki Shimozawa is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Clinical Biochemistry and Physi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Nobuyuki Shimozawa has authored 216 papers receiving a total of 5.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 171 papers in Molecular Biology, 71 papers in Clinical Biochemistry and 67 papers in Physiology. Recurrent topics in Nobuyuki Shimozawa’s work include Peroxisome Proliferator-Activated Receptors (147 papers), Metabolism and Genetic Disorders (71 papers) and Adipose Tissue and Metabolism (32 papers). Nobuyuki Shimozawa is often cited by papers focused on Peroxisome Proliferator-Activated Receptors (147 papers), Metabolism and Genetic Disorders (71 papers) and Adipose Tissue and Metabolism (32 papers). Nobuyuki Shimozawa collaborates with scholars based in Japan, The Netherlands and United States. Nobuyuki Shimozawa's co-authors include Yasuyuki Suzuki, Yukio Fujiki, Naomi Kondo, Tadao Orii, Toshiro Tsukamoto, Shigehiko Tamura, Takashi Osumi, Ronald J. A. Wanders, Tsuneo Imanaka and Yasuyuki Suzuki and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and Journal of Biological Chemistry.
